Housekeeping Supervisor

Study HotelsPhiladelphia, PA

About The Position

The Study at University City is seeking a highly organized and detail-oriented Housekeeping Supervisor to support and mentor our Housekeeping team. This role oversees the daily operations of guest rooms, public areas, and laundry while ensuring a clean, comfortable, and consistent guest experience aligned with Study Hotels brand standards. The Housekeeping Supervisor partners closely with the Director of Housekeeping to lead team performance, maintain quality standards, and support efficient daily operations. This position requires strong attention to detail, leadership skills, and the 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ced hospitality environment. Our caring and attentive associates reinforce our belief that guest service is our highest priority. We seek energetic, service-oriented individuals who take pride in delivering exceptional cleanliness and memorable guest experiences. Housekeeping Operations Snapshot 212-room full-service hotel Guest rooms, public spaces, and laundry operations High-touch service environment with focus on quality and consistency Coordination with Front Office, Engineering, and Food & Beverage teams Fast-paced operation supporting university, corporate, and group business Team-focused culture with emphasis on training, development, and accountability

Responsibilities

  • Supervise daily housekeeping operations including room attendants, public areas, and laundry team.
  • Inspect guest rooms, public areas, and back-of-house spaces to ensure quality and cleanliness standards are met.
  • Assign and manage daily boards and workloads for housekeeping team members.
  • Train, mentor, and support team members to ensure accountability and consistent performance.
  • Maintain inventory levels for linens, uniforms, and housekeeping supplies.
  • Support and implement cleaning and preventative maintenance programs.
  • Respond promptly to guest requests and resolve concerns to ensure guest satisfaction.
  • Partner with other departments to support hotel operations and guest needs.
  • Assist in scheduling and staffing to align with occupancy and business levels.
  • Promote a positive, team-oriented work environment focused on service and quality.
  • Ensure compliance with safety, sanitation, and operational standards.
  • Perform additional duties as assigned to support hotel operations.
